Output 61bd7d22d9a41057e22314b5feb57d7ed1a101ec67c629e4f28fd7a4d2a89657:68

value
10663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 084ea3a30b3000ccd7ee2c26cdb51effe1a375a7d4838311b40696079cdab507
address
bc1ppp828gctxqqve4lw9snvmdg7lls6xad86jpcxyd5q6tq08x6k5rssyfxx3
transaction
61bd7d22d9a41057e22314b5feb57d7ed1a101ec67c629e4f28fd7a4d2a89657
spent
true